是因为DatePicker是一个系统控件,其外观和样式是由操作系统来控制的,因此无法直接更改字体颜色。不过,可以通过以下方式间接改变字体颜色:
- 使用自定义样式:如果你的应用程序支持自定义样式,可以尝试创建一个自定义的DatePicker样式,并在样式中设置字体颜色。具体的实现方法会因操作系统和开发环境而异,你可以参考相关的文档或开发者指南来进行操作。
- 使用第三方库或组件:有些第三方库或组件提供了可以自定义DatePicker样式的功能,你可以尝试集成这些库或组件,并按照其文档进行配置和设置,以实现字体颜色的改变。
- 使用反射技术(仅限于某些开发环境):在某些开发环境中,你可以使用反射技术来获取DatePicker的内部属性,然后通过修改这些属性来改变字体颜色。不过,这种做法可能比较复杂且不可靠,可能会影响应用程序的稳定性和可移植性,所以建议谨慎使用。
总之,虽然无法直接更改DatePicker字体颜色,但可以通过一些间接的方式来实现这个目标。具体的实现方法会根据你的开发环境和需求而有所不同,请参考相关的文档或开发者指南来获取更详细的信息。